I came up with the name in a drunken stupor one evening so I wrote a recipe to fit the name. Pretty much a dunkelweissen with rye added. Geistbier wanted the recipe so I thought I would post it here. Not quite to style for a dunkelweissen (or any other beer) but is a tasty brew.

Bugeater Dunkelroggenweisen

A ProMash Recipe Report

BJCP Style and Style Guidelines
-------------------------------

15-B German Wheat and Rye Beer, Dunkelweizen

Min OG: 1.044 Max OG: 1.056
Min IBU: 10 Max IBU: 18
Min Clr: 14 Max Clr: 23 Color in SRM, Lovibond

Recipe Specifics
----------------

Batch Size (Gal): 5.50 Wort Size (Gal): 5.50
Total Grain (Lbs): 10.88
Anticipated OG: 1.051 Plato: 12.67
Anticipated SRM: 18.4
Anticipated IBU: 17.2
Brewhouse Efficiency: 70 %
Wort Boil Time: 60 Minutes

Pre-Boil Amounts
----------------

Evaporation Rate: 1.50 Gallons Per Hour
Pre-Boil Wort Size: 7.00 Gal
Pre-Boil Gravity: 1.040 SG 10.05 Plato


Grain/Extract/Sugar

% Amount Name Origin Potential SRM
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
36.8 4.00 lbs. Pilsener Germany 1.038 2
9.2 1.00 lbs. Rye Malt America 1.030 4
46.0 5.00 lbs. Wheat Malt America 1.038 2
4.6 0.50 lbs. Munich Malt Germany 1.037 8
1.1 0.13 lbs. Chocolate Malt Great Britain 1.034 475
2.3 0.25 lbs. Carafa Chocolate Malt Germany 1.030 525

Potential represented as SG per pound per gallon.


Hops

Amount Name Form Alpha IBU Boil Time
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
0.50 oz. Czech Saaz Whole 3.30 5.3 First WH
0.75 oz. Hallertauer Whole 3.90 11.8 60 min.
0.50 oz. Czech Saaz Whole 3.30 0.0 0 min.


Yeast
-----
WYeast 3056 Bavarian Wheat

Water Profile
-------------
Profile: Ashland 50/50

Calcium(Ca): 35.0 ppm
Magnesium(Mg): 7.5 ppm
Sodium(Na): 15.0 ppm
Sulfate(SO4): 36.0 ppm
Chloride(Cl): 0.0 ppm
biCarbonate(HCO3): 118.3 ppm

pH: 8.33

Mash Schedule
-------------
Mash Type: Single Step

Grain Lbs: 10.88
Water Qts: 16.31 - Before Additional Infusions
Water Gal: 4.08 - Before Additional Infusions

Qts Water Per Lbs Grain: 1.50 - Before Additional Infusions

Saccharification Rest Temp : 150 Time: 60
Mash-out Rest Temp : 180 Time: 5
Sparge Temp : 170 Time: 0
